Why Choose Asymmetrical Dresses for the Mother of the Bride?

Asymmetrical dresses are designed with varying hemlines, often featuring one side that is shorter or longer than the other, creating an elegant flow. This unique silhouette draws the eye in a way that elongates and slims the body, making it a great choice for MOB dresses. Aside from their visual appeal, these dresses also allow for movement and comfort—two important aspects for anyone attending a long ceremony and reception.

The Benefits of Asymmetry for Every Body Type

One of the main advantages of asymmetrical mother of the bride dresses is that they can be flattering for any body type. Here's how they work for different body shapes:

1. Hourglass Figure

For those with an hourglass shape, asymmetrical dresses help to accentuate curves while balancing proportions. Dresses with an asymmetrical neckline or hemline create a flattering flow that enhances the natural curves of the waist and hips. These dresses can also be styled with a belt or fitted waist to highlight the smaller part of the body, making it a go-to choice for an elegant and feminine look.

2. Pear-Shaped Bodies

Pear-shaped women tend to have narrower shoulders and wider hips. Asymmetrical dresses, particularly those with a higher hemline in the front, draw attention away from the hips and elongate the legs. The strategic asymmetry can bring attention to the upper body, especially when combined with a more elaborate neckline or details on the shoulders, creating a balanced silhouette.

3. Apple-Shaped Bodies

Apple-shaped bodies are typically broader around the chest and waist. An asymmetrical dress with a diagonal or cascading hemline can create the illusion of a slimmer waistline, drawing attention away from the midsection. A dress that falls gently from the bust down to the hips with soft draping will also provide a slimming effect. Paired with a high neckline or off-shoulder design, it will balance out the proportions beautifully.

4. Petite Figures

Petite women often struggle to find dresses that don’t overwhelm their frame. Asymmetrical dresses are perfect because they add height and elongate the body. A high-low dress or one with an asymmetrical hemline can give the illusion of longer legs, creating a more balanced and flattering appearance. Petite women should look for dresses with diagonal or vertical lines to avoid looking too boxy.

5. Plus-Size Figures

For plus-size women, asymmetrical cuts can be a game-changer. The angle of the hemline draws attention away from problem areas and can create a more defined shape. Dresses with soft draping and a flowing silhouette help to cover the hips and thighs while still showcasing the upper body beautifully. Look for dresses with an asymmetrical neckline that balances the bust, or opt for dresses with a subtle off-the-shoulder design to add a touch of elegance without compromising comfort.

Different Styles of Asymmetrical Mother of the Bride Dresses

Asymmetrical dresses come in various styles, and there’s something for every MOB, no matter the personal taste. Here are a few options to consider:

1. Asymmetrical Hemline Dresses

A classic asymmetrical hemline creates a beautiful flow from one side to the other. These dresses are perfect for MOBs who want to show off their legs while keeping a sense of class. They can be floor-length or knee-length, depending on your preference, and work well in both formal and semi-formal wedding settings.

2. Asymmetrical Necklines

Asymmetrical necklines add a modern twist to traditional MOB dresses. One shoulder designs are especially flattering, creating a bold, elegant look while drawing attention to the neckline and collarbones. These dresses can be paired with intricate jewelry or a sleek updo to create a striking ensemble.

3. One-Shoulder Dresses

A one-shoulder asymmetrical design is not only flattering but adds a timeless, glamorous touch to the dress. This style works well for all body types as it draws attention upward and creates an elegant look without being too fussy. Whether in satin, chiffon, or lace, one-shoulder dresses exude confidence and class.

4. Layered and Draped Designs

For a more romantic and soft look, layered and draped asymmetrical dresses create a gentle flow. These dresses are perfect for adding a touch of whimsy while still looking polished. The layers can be arranged in various ways, creating visual interest and enhancing the figure.
